925 is a marking for sterling silver , Italy is where it is from and ITAOR Is the designer of the jewelry .
A gold necklace stamped "ITAOR" likely indicates the piece's origin or manufacturer, as "ITAOR" is not a standard hallmark or gold purity mark. It could represent a brand or designer name, or even a specific collection. To determine its exact significance, it may be helpful to research the brand or consult a jeweler familiar with jewelry markings. Always ensure the authenticity by checking the gold content and seeking professional evaluation if needed.
